开源之力:为 Linux 实现监控自动化(linux开源监控)

关键

开源之力:在Linux系统上实现监控自动化

Linux是几乎所有信息技术领域中最受欢迎的操作系统之一,广泛应用于数据中心、网络构架、移动体系架构等等。它的开源性致使系统管理极度灵活,操作者可以自由的配置Linux系统,实现其系统的优化、一致性和效率提高。

随着业务发展,Linux系统性能管理势在必行。这之中,监控自动化正是一项重要技术手段。将用户监控到数据库事件、实时网络事件、实时服务器负载等等各种系统状态,并设计系统的响应措施,比如发送预警,比如自动重启服务或监控agent,以确保服务的可用性和稳定性。

为了实现 Linux 监控自动化,开源社区不但提供多种可以轻松部署的监控工具,还为操作者提供大量的解决方案和参考文档,例如Nagios、Cacti、Ganglia等。

至于部署监控工具,操作者可以在Linux系统上使用开源项目中提供的自动化部署工具,比如saltstack、Chef、Ansible等,以实现快速的Linux系统的监控部署。

操作者也可以通过编写脚本以及自动任务框架,实现自动化监控,例如编写一个定时任务,定期去检查服务器是否存在异常,如果存在,那么接着就做出对应的处理。

自动化监控不仅可以体现Linux操作系统的优良性能,更重要的是能够及时地做出响应,避免数据损失或系统失效。使得Linux系统更能保持可用性和完整性,更为企业带来收益。

总之,开源社区提供的大量开源工具,以及操作者的监控自动化解决方案,为Linux系统的监控自动化提供了可靠的保障。未来,Linux系统在数据中心、企业网络和移动体系架构中将会成为不可被忽视的力量。


数据运维技术 » 开源之力:为 Linux 实现监控自动化(linux开源监控)